Exactly. If the car is clean before you put the cover on you won't have to worry about the cover scratching the car.

The factory cover is actually made of a good material for an in between balance of indoor and outdoor use, it's gonna shed water really good with good breathability. You may want to look into getting a strictly outdoor use cover in your circumstance though, because other outdoor only covers are actually thicker and will help defend against small dings and dents as well. Here's a good chart from Covercraft that will help answer your questions...

FYI.... the factory GT350 cover is the Weathershield HD material.
